Abstract The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) has established a waste minimization research program within the Office of Research and Development's Risk Reduction Engineering Laboratory which is the primary contact for pollution prevention research efforts concentrating on source reduction and recycling. The paper provides an overview of the Waste Minimization Branch's research programs and to discuss the progress of specific projects. Through four major program areas, the Branch identifies and evaluates relevant production operations and waste management practices, demonstrates waste reduction techniques and technologies, designs and tests prototypes of waste management systems, performs model waste minimization assessments for public and private pollution prevention operation, and participates in a variety of technology transfer activities.
